Bonjour à tous,
J’ai un script qui créé une stratégie d’imprimante (mappage d’une imprimante réseau dans la session et affectation à un groupe).
Par contre , je n’arrive pas à trouver (si cela existe) comment faire pour définir cette imprimante comme imprimante par défaut (il est par exemple possible de définir l’imprimante par défaut du client comme imprimante par défaut dans sa session Citrix).
J’espère être assez clair; et que vous pourrez m’aider.
D’avance merci.
Le soucis des sessions printers, c’est l’imprimante par defaut car à chaque log off elles sont deconnectées.
Pour régler ton problème, il faut modifie rune clès de registre pour eviter la deconnexion DisableNetworkPrinterDisconnect (http://support.citrix.com/article/CTX124885), est demander à tes utilisateurs de choisir l’imprimante par défaut la première fois.
Merci pour ta réponse.
Malheureusement ce n’est pas possible, car les utilisateurs n’ont accès à leur imprimante qu’à travers l’application (qui plus est merdique).
D’autre part, nous sommes en Xenapp 5, et non en 6.
Si je ne trouve pas comment le scripter, il me faudra passer sur les 400 imprimantes, et sélectionner l’imprimante de session associée par défaut…
Donc si quelqu’un avait une idée…
Merci d’avance.
hop
ce flag existe en XA6.x et dans CPS4.X/XA5.0 (pour ces derniers, Citrix Printing Tool t’aidera)
Cependant, cela ne fonctionne QUE si CpSvc.exe (le service de gestion des printers Citrix) s’occupe de l’autocreation et si toi tu as un script qui ajoute l’imprimante alors c’est pas Citrix qui s’en occupe…
pour configurer l’imprimante par défaut, soit defaultprinter.exe (google est ton pote) soit prnui.dll soit WMI soit API Win32